In a major leap toward self-reliance in defense technology, India is set to develop its very own fifth-generation fighter jet—the Advanced Medium Combat Aircraft (AMCA) . In a historic move, Defence Minister Rajnath Singh has approved an innovative execution model for the indigenous stealth fighter programme. This model brings together Hindustan Aeronautics Limited (HAL) and private industry players in a competitive framework, marking a significant shift in how India approaches military aviation manufacturing. This bold initiative comes at a critical time, as China has already fielded two fifth-generation fighters , and reports indicate it will supply 40 J-35 stealth jets to Pakistan . Against this backdrop, fast-tracking the AMCA has become an urgent national security imperative. Selective Silencing: Understanding Its Role in Disease Outcomes and Genetic Expression Researchers at Columbia University have revealed the fascinating concept of selective silencing and its potential impact on disease outcomes. This process involves the selective inactivation of one copy of a gene inherited from one parent, which can influence genetic expression and potentially affect disease susceptibility. Here's a detailed explanation: 1. Understanding Selective Silencing Gene Copies in Cells : Every cell in the body (except sperm and eggs) contains two copies of each gene, inherited from both parents. Selective Inactivation : In some cells, one of the copies of a gene is selectively silenced , meaning it is blocked from expressing its genetic message. This selective silencing can affect how genes function and influence an individual's overall health. 2.
